The db sync retry tenacity decorator has the folloing settings:

stop_after_attempt(3),
wait_exponential(multiplier=1, min=10, max=300)

This translates to:
run dbsync
wait 10 ((2^0 * 1) < 10 -> 10)
run dbsync
wait 10 ((2^1 * 1) < 10 -> 10)
run dbsync
exit

So, the three db sync command run within ~20s. Increasing the number
of attempts keeps the exponential back-off behaviour but gives the
command more change to work.

"""Base classes for defining a charm using the Operator framework.
This library provided OSBaseOperatorCharm and OSBaseOperatorAPICharm. The
charm classes use ops_sunbeam.relation_handlers.RelationHandler objects
to interact with relations. These objects also provide contexts which
can be used when defining templates.
In addition to the Relation handlers the charm class can also use
ops_sunbeam.config_contexts.ConfigContext objects which can be
used when rendering templates, these are not specific to a relation.
The charm class interacts with the containers it is managing via
ops_sunbeam.container_handlers.PebbleHandler. The PebbleHandler
defines the pebble layers, manages pushing configuration to the
containers and managing the service running in the container.
"""

@tenacity.retry(
stop=tenacity.stop_after_attempt(10),
retry=(
tenacity.retry_if_exception_type(ops.pebble.ChangeError)
| tenacity.retry_if_exception_type(ops.pebble.ExecError)
),
after=tenacity.after_log(logger, logging.WARNING),
wait=tenacity.wait_exponential(multiplier=1, min=10, max=300),
)
def _retry_db_sync(self, cmd):
container = self.unit.get_container(self.db_sync_container_name)
logging.debug("Running sync: \n%s", cmd)
process = container.exec(cmd, timeout=5 * 60)
out, warnings = process.wait_output()
if warnings:
for line in warnings.splitlines():
logger.warning("DB Sync Out: %s", line.strip())
logging.debug("Output from database sync: \n%s", out)
@sunbeam_job_ctrl.run_once_per_unit("db-sync")
def run_db_sync(self) -> None:
"""Run DB sync to init DB.
:raises: pebble.ExecError
"""
if not self.unit.is_leader():
logging.info("Not lead unit, skipping DB syncs")
return
try:
if self.db_sync_cmds:
logger.info("Syncing database...")
for cmd in self.db_sync_cmds:
try:
self._retry_db_sync(cmd)
except tenacity.RetryError:
raise sunbeam_guard.BlockedExceptionError(
"DB sync failed"
)
except AttributeError:
logger.warning(
"Not DB sync ran. Charm does not specify self.db_sync_cmds"
)
